This free online Interconnecting Cisco Networking Devices Part 1 (ICND1) v3 CCNA course will teach you everything you need to know about Interconnecting Cisco Networking Devices. The Interconnecting Cisco Networking Devices Part 1 (ICND1) is the exam associated with the Cisco Certified Entry Network Technician certification and a tangible first step, second being ICND2, in achieving the Cisco Certified Network Associate certification.

  • Building a Simple Network

    In this module, Building a Simple Network, students will learn about networking functions, understanding the host-to-host communications model, introducing LANs, introduction to the IOS, starting a switch, understanding ethernet and switch operation, troubleshooting common switch media issues, perform switch startup, troubleshooting switch media issues, and command-line help.

    Establishing Internet Connectivity

    In this module, Establishing Internet Connectivity, students will learn to understand the TCP/IP internet layer, understand IP addressing and subnets, understand the TCP/IP transport layer, explore the functions of routing, configure a Cisco router, explore the packet delivery process, enable static routing, manage traffic using ACLs, enable internet connectivity, perform initial router setup media issues, connect to the internet, and understand the life of a packet.

    Managing Network Device Security

    In this module, Managing Network Device Security, students will learn about securing administrative access, implementing device hardening, implementing traffic filtering with ACLs, enhancing the security of the initial configuration, device hardening, filtering traffic with ACLs, configuring SSH, configuring NTP, AAA, and DHCP snooping.
